Except for command arguments, event data, and members of enum and object types: these the generator silently "documents" as "Not documented". We can't require proper documentation there without first fixing all the offenders. We've always had too many offenders to pull that off. Right now, we have more than 500. Worse, we seem to fix old ones no faster than we add new ones: in the past year, we fixed 22 ones, but added 26 new ones. PATCH 01-05 are bonus fixes & cleanups. PATCH 06 makes missing documentation an error unless the command, type, or event is in listed in new pragma documentation-exceptions. PATCH 07-09 improve the "QEMU Guest Agent Protocol Reference" manual: they document eight members and arguments, reducing the number of offending commands and types from nine to one. The 25 members of type GuestNVMeSmart are left undocumented. PATCH 10-15 improve reduce the "QEMU QMP Reference Manual" manual, but only a bit: they document 54 members and arguments, reducing number of offending commands and types from 117 to 65. 467 members and arguments are left undocumented. A few of them are not actually used in QMP, and documenting them is not worthwhile; they should be elided from the manual instead. Example: DummyForceArrays.
